Volusia County Clerk of Courts
The Volusia County Clerk maintains all Deltona criminal court records. The main courthouse is in DeLand. The address is 101 North Alabama Avenue. This historic building houses court operations. The clerk serves a large geographic area. Volusia County covers over 1,100 square miles. Records management is essential.

Types of Criminal Records Available
Deltona criminal court records cover many case types. Felony cases are the most serious. Violent crimes are felonies. Drug trafficking qualifies. Major property crimes are included. These cases generate extensive files. The clerk maintains all records.
Misdemeanor cases are also documented. Simple battery is a misdemeanor. Petty theft falls here. Some DUI cases are misdemeanors. Disorderly conduct is included. These records appear in background checks. Employment screening may reveal them. Housing applications can be affected.
Traffic criminal cases form another category. Driving with a suspended license qualifies. Leaving an accident scene is serious. Vehicular homicide is the most severe. These affect driving privileges. Insurance rates may increase. Employment driving jobs are impacted.
Juvenile records have special protections. Florida law restricts access. Parents can view their child's records. Attorneys have access for representation. Law enforcement uses them appropriately. The general public is excluded. Privacy is strongly protected. Rehabilitation is prioritized.
Accessing Deltona Criminal Court Records
Multiple methods exist for obtaining records. Online search is most convenient. The clerk's website operates around the clock. Basic information is free. Copies may require payment. Credit cards are accepted. Results appear instantly. This saves time and travel.
In-person visits provide full access. The DeLand courthouse is open weekdays. Staff help locate records. Viewing files is free. Copies cost money. Certified copies cost more. Payment methods are varied. Cash and cards are accepted.
Mail requests work for distant requesters. Include complete case information. Provide the defendant's full name. Add date of birth if known. Include case numbers when available. Send payment with the request. Processing takes several days. Records are mailed when ready.
Criminal Background Check Options
Background checks for Deltona residents use multiple sources. The Florida Department of Law Enforcement offers statewide coverage. All sixty-seven counties are included. Volusia County data is current. The cost is twenty-four dollars per search. Payment is online by card.
Local checks through the Volusia Clerk show more detail. Complete case files are viewable. All court documents are accessible. Final dispositions are clear. Statewide checks may lack this depth. Using both sources is recommended. Many situations require both levels.
Note: Processing times vary based on the method chosen, with online FDLE checks typically completing within minutes while local certified copies may take several business days.
